Recreational water quality is commonly assessed by microbial indicators such as fecal coliforms. Maceió is the capital of Alagoas state, located in tropical northeastern Brazil. Its beaches are considered as the most beautiful urban beaches in the country. Jatiúca Beach in Maceió was found to be unsuitable for bathing continuously during the year of 2011. The same level of contamination was not observed in surrounding beaches. The aim of this study was to initiate the search for the sources of these high coliform levels, so that contamination can be eventually mitigated. We performed a retrospective analysis of historical results of fecal coliform concentrations from 2006 to 2012 at five monitoring stations located in the study region. Results showed that Jatiúca Beach consistently presented the worst quality among the studied beaches. A field survey was conducted to identify existing point and non-point sources of pollution in the area. Monitoring in the vicinity of Jatiúca was spatially intensified. Fecal coliform concentrations were categorized according to tide range and tide stage. A storm drain located in northern Jatiúca was identified as the main point source of the contamination. However, fecal coliform concentrations at Jatiúca were high during high tides and spring tides even when this point source was inactive (no rainfall). We hypothesize that high fecal coliform levels in Jatiúca Beach may also be caused by aquifer contamination or, more likely, from tide washing of contaminated sand. Both of these hypotheses will be further investigated.

Four types of carbonated soft drinks encoded as A; B; C and D; and bottled and sealed water E (used as control) were bought from a student restaurant in the Rivers State University of Science and Technology; Port Harcourt Nigeria. The area of the orifice and neck of the bottles usually placed in the mouth while drinking directly from the bottles was analyzed in triplicates for the impinging bacterial species. Of the eighty-three morphologically identified aerobic isolates the percent frequency of occurrence was: Staphylococcus aureus (38.4); Bacillus and other gram-positive rods (36.0); Enterococcus sp (12.0); Micrococcus spp (8.4each); and Proteus and Pseudomonas spp (2.4each). The Standard Plate Count expressed as the Colony Forming Units (CFU) indicated a range of 5.3 x 10 3 to 2.6.0 x 10 4 CFU ml-1 of the rinsate of the orifice and neck of the soft-drink bottles. The preponderance of the indicator organisms: Coagulase positive S. aureus and the Enterococci sp is used to infer the presence of potentially pathogenic bacteria. The need for public health enlightenment on the packaging and safe conduits for the distribution of soft drinks was discussed

Objective: Microbiological assessment of commonly available antimicrobial agents in Ilala Municipality. Methodology The disc diffusion method was used for the determination of antimicrobial activities. Results:Amoxicillin exhibited ZI between 21mm (Elys) and 23mm (Zenufa) against E. coli; and between 21mm and 23mm (Elys) against S. aureus. Ampicillin samples yielded ZI from 20mm (India) to 25mm (Keko) against both bacteria. Dicloxacillin exhibited ZI between 13mm (Keko) and 16mm (India; Keko) against E. coli and from 15mm (Keko) to 18mm (Shelys) against S.aureus. Ciprofloxacin samples (India) exhibited ZI between 22mm and 25mm against both bacteria. On the other hand ketoconazole exhibited ZI between 16.5 and 19.0 mm against both Candida albicans and Cryptoccocus neoformans. Nystatin (Cyprus) produced ZI between 10 and 12mm against both fungi; similarly Fluconazole (India) yielded between 16.5 and 20mm of ZI against both C. albicans and C. neoformans. Conclusion The antimicrobial agents analyzed in this study have demonstrated substantial antimicrobial activities against the test microorganisms; an indicative of possession of active ingredients. As far as the in vitro microbiological assays are concerned; the study's findings could not reveal any counterfeit drug. However; further studies should be conducted to confirm the content specifications and other relevant parameters of each pharmaceutical preparation
